  1. The position of the child (Balasana)

Balasana is a good way to feel better. It has a good effect on the ankles and hips, and it stretches the whole back in a beautiful way. Let go and sink deeply into the ground during the child’s pose. While we’re at it, we can let go of our responsibilities and other things that are getting in the way and relax our minds.

A lot of stress can be relieved by this huge amount of calm and cool. If you take care of your nerves, they can grow back. This helps your adrenal glands and reproductive glands work better, too! This, in turn, can help our hair stay healthy and grow faster.

  1. Adho Mukha Svanasana (Downward facing dog pose)

This beautiful and strong pose is weight-bearing and will help you strengthen your arms and legs. It’s also a beautiful pose. It also opens the sides of your body, which widens the lungs. This asana can help you get more oxygen in your whole body. There is more gravity, so the blood flow into the brain goes up. It strengthens the hair follicles when oxygenated blood flows to the brain. This makes hair grow faster, as well.

This can help the scalp. Where there is more blood flow, hair can be cleaned and nourished. During this time, hair growth and healing will also happen to the scalp. Among the many things, the pituitary gland in your brain controls your metabolism, growth, and sexual maturity. It is also known as the “master gland.” When you do the Downward dog pose, your brain will get more blood. This will also help your master gland. It can help people who have problems with their hormones. This, in turn, can help hair grow in a good way.

3. Kapalbhati

Kapalbhati is a very good way to clean your body. People who breathe in a rhythmic way and move their stomachs clean their internal organs and blood flow improves. You can’t beat the regeneration and rejuvenation that happens when you do Kapalbhati every day.

People notice that their minds are calm and focused right after they practice. When you do this pose, your nervous system relaxes and your body, mind, and soul all start to heal at the same time. Because it’s rejuvenating, hormonal imbalances can also be fixed. Hair follicle growth can also be encouraged, which is good for you.
